Some people have seemed to have trouble flashing the file - I believe this is due to botched downloads as I'm using free servers that are struggling with the size of the file.

Therefore, before attempting a flash, please review the file size properties.

For your reference:

Size - 284 MB (298,481,286 bytes)
Size on Disk - 284 MB (298,483,712 bytes)

If they don't match, re-download.

I'll edit the OP to reflect this as well.

please be patient as i plan on getting into a lot of detail with results from using this file.

the phone situation...new not refurb Droid X, running 2.3.340 OTA, rooted with no rom, stock if you will. was using the wifi tether and TBH 3g hack, also had the rummX boot logo left over from 2.3.15.

the issue...phone would reboot no less than 15 times per day. unlocking the phone, turning it sideways, these things would trigger a reboot. i have been following this thread so i requested a beta copy of the OTA zip file from mader, he was nice enough to give me a copy.

the results...file was loaded through bootstrap, just like you would a rom or theme. it literally finished going through its processes in about 5-7 minutes. first thing i noticed was the "M" logo come up, that took a bit of time, then the word "droid", then the magic red eye and the slight vibration, all good news if you have ever loaded a rom or theme. then the phone sliders and the same wallpaper were visible. slid the unlock slider and all appeared to be exactly as i left it. same number of screens, all icons were in the same place, nothing appeared to have moved. even the super ninja icon was there but was different in appearance. i went to terminal and typed "su" and got the message, superuser permissions denied...went to bootstrap, also got the error, went to root explorer and could not access system files. I did have to reprogam the phone as it would not make any calls...a simple *228, option #1 and a few minutes later was good to go. all missed texts, emails and missed calls came in after that. 2 hours later and not one single reboot.

conclusion...THIS FILE WORKS AS ADVERTISED, BACK TO COMPLETE STOCK WITH NO ROOT ACCESS AND NO ILL EFFECTS!!!!
